[go: up one dir, main page]

WO2018214113A1 - Procédé et système d'application d'adresses de réseau virtuel dans une liaison de réseau - Google Patents

Procédé et système d'application d'adresses de réseau virtuel dans une liaison de réseau Download PDF

Info

Publication number
WO2018214113A1
WO2018214113A1 PCT/CN2017/085971 CN2017085971W WO2018214113A1 WO 2018214113 A1 WO2018214113 A1 WO 2018214113A1 CN 2017085971 W CN2017085971 W CN 2017085971W WO 2018214113 A1 WO2018214113 A1 WO 2018214113A1
Authority
WO
WIPO (PCT)
Prior art keywords
virtual network
address
network address
data packet
mapping relationship
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Ceased
Application number
PCT/CN2017/085971
Other languages
English (en)
Chinese (zh)
Inventor
李炜
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Shenzhen Yiteli Network Technology Co Ltd
Original Assignee
Shenzhen Yiteli Network Technology Co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Shenzhen Yiteli Network Technology Co Ltd filed Critical Shenzhen Yiteli Network Technology Co Ltd
Priority to PCT/CN2017/085971 priority Critical patent/WO2018214113A1/fr
Publication of WO2018214113A1 publication Critical patent/WO2018214113A1/fr
Anticipated expiration legal-status Critical
Ceased legal-status Critical Current

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L61/00Network arrangements, protocols or services for addressing or naming

Definitions

  • the present invention relates to the field of communications, and in particular, to a method and system for applying a virtual network address in a network link.
  • a network link is a link for sending data in a network.
  • the existing network address is limited. Therefore, if a large number of terminals are connected, communication cannot be performed, thereby affecting the customer experience.
  • a method for applying a virtual network address in a network link is provided, which solves the disadvantage of poor customer experience in the prior art.
  • a method for applying a virtual network address in a network link includes the following steps:
  • the method further includes:
  • the virtual network address corresponding to the destination MAC address is searched from the mapping relationship, and the destination IP address of the data packet is changed to the Virtual network address.
  • the method further includes:
  • mapping relationship is deleted.
  • an application system for a virtual network address in a network link includes:
  • An acquiring unit configured to acquire the number of terminals accessed in the local area network, and if the quantity exceeds a set threshold, allocate a virtual network address to the terminal;
  • mapping unit configured to establish a mapping relationship between a virtual network address and a MAC address
  • control unit configured to replace the virtual network address in the data packet with a local IP address, such as a data packet sent by the terminal that receives the virtual network address.
  • system further includes:
  • control unit configured to: if receiving a data packet sent by the network device, if the destination MAC address of the data packet is different from the local MAC address, the virtual network address corresponding to the destination MAC address is searched from the mapping relationship, and the destination of the data packet is The IP address is changed to the virtual network address.
  • system further includes:
  • control unit configured to delete the mapping relationship if the number of the terminals is lower than a quantity threshold.
  • a computer readable storage medium having stored thereon a computer program that, when executed by a processor, implements the method of applying the virtual network address in a network link.
  • a terminal comprising one or more processors, a memory, a transceiver, and one or more programs, the one or more programs being stored in the memory and configured by the Executed by one or more processors, the program including instructions for performing the steps in the application method of the virtual network address described above in the network link.
  • the technical solution provided by the specific embodiment of the present invention acquires the number of terminals accessed in the local area network. If the number exceeds the set threshold, the terminal allocates a virtual network address, and establishes a mapping relationship between the virtual network address and the MAC address, such as receiving.
  • the data packet sent by the terminal to the virtual network address replaces the virtual network address in the data packet with the local IP address, so it has the advantages of real-time allocation and maintenance of the virtual network address, realizing virtual network address communication, and improving user experience. .
  • FIG. 1 is a flowchart of a method for applying a virtual network address in a network link according to the present invention.
  • FIG. 2 is a structural diagram of an application system of a virtual network address in a network link according to the present invention.
  • FIG. 3 is a schematic structural diagram of hardware of a terminal provided by the present invention.
  • FIG. 1 is a flowchart of a method for applying a virtual network address in a network link according to a first preferred embodiment of the present invention.
  • the method is implemented by a node, and the method is as shown in FIG. Including the following steps:
  • Step S101 Obtain a number of terminals accessed in the local area network, and if the number exceeds a set threshold, allocate a virtual network address to the terminal;
  • Step S102 Establish a mapping relationship between a virtual network address and a MAC address.
  • Step S103 If the data packet sent by the terminal that receives the virtual network address receives the virtual network address in the data packet, replace the IP address with the local address.
  • the technical solution provided by the specific embodiment of the present invention acquires the number of terminals accessed in the local area network. If the number exceeds the set threshold, the terminal allocates a virtual network address, and establishes a mapping relationship between the virtual network address and the MAC address, such as receiving.
  • the data packet sent by the terminal to the virtual network address replaces the virtual network address in the data packet with the local IP address, so it has the advantages of real-time allocation and maintenance of the virtual network address, realizing virtual network address communication, and improving user experience. .
  • the method may further include:
  • the virtual network address corresponding to the destination MAC address is searched from the mapping relationship, and the destination IP address of the data packet is changed to the Virtual network address.
  • the method may further include:
  • mapping relationship is deleted.
  • FIG. 2 is a schematic diagram of a virtual network address application system in a network link according to a second preferred embodiment of the present invention.
  • the system as shown in FIG. 2, includes:
  • the obtaining unit 201 is configured to acquire the number of terminals accessed in the local area network, and if the number exceeds a set threshold, allocate a virtual network address to the terminal;
  • the mapping unit 202 is configured to establish a mapping relationship between the virtual network address and the MAC address.
  • the control unit 203 is configured to replace the virtual network address in the data packet with the IP address of the locality as the data packet sent by the terminal that receives the virtual network address.
  • the technical solution provided by the specific embodiment of the present invention acquires the number of terminals accessed in the local area network. If the number exceeds the set threshold, the terminal allocates a virtual network address, and establishes a mapping relationship between the virtual network address and the MAC address, such as receiving.
  • the data packet sent by the terminal to the virtual network address replaces the virtual network address in the data packet with the local IP address, so it has the advantages of real-time allocation and maintenance of the virtual network address, realizing virtual network address communication, and improving user experience. .
  • the above system may further include:
  • the control unit 203 is configured to: if the data packet sent by the network device is received, if the destination MAC address of the data packet is different from the local MAC address, the virtual network address corresponding to the destination MAC address is searched from the mapping relationship, and the data packet is The destination IP address is changed to the virtual network address.
  • the above system may further include:
  • the control unit 203 is configured to delete the mapping relationship if the number of the terminals is lower than the quantity threshold.
  • Embodiments of the present invention also provide a computer readable storage medium having stored thereon a computer program that, when executed by a processor, implements the method of applying the virtual network address in a network link.
  • a specific embodiment of the present invention further provides a node, as shown in FIG. 3, including one or more processors 302, a memory 301, a transceiver 303, and one or more programs, the one or more programs being stored in The memory is, and is configured to be executed by, the one or more processors, the program comprising instructions for performing the steps in the method of applying the virtual network address described above in a network link.
  • Computer readable media includes both computer storage media and communication media including any medium that facilitates transfer of a computer program from one location to another.
  • a storage medium may be any available media that can be accessed by a computer.
  • the computer readable medium may include random access memory (Random) Access Memory, RAM), Read-Only Memory (ROM), Electrically Erasable Programmable Read Only Memory (Electrically Erasable Programmable Read-Only Memory, EEPROM), Compact Disc Read-Only Memory, CD-ROM, or other optical disc storage, magnetic storage medium or other magnetic storage device, or any other medium that can be used to carry or store desired program code in the form of instructions or data structures and that can be accessed by a computer. Also. Any connection may suitably be a computer readable medium.
  • a disk and a disc include a compact disc (CD), a laser disc, a compact disc, a digital versatile disc (DVD), a floppy disk, and a Blu-ray disc, wherein the disc is usually magnetically copied, and the disc is The laser is used to optically replicate the data. Combinations of the above should also be included within the scope of the computer readable media.

Landscapes

  • Engineering & Computer Science (AREA)
  • Computer Networks & Wireless Communication (AREA)
  • Signal Processing (AREA)
  • Data Exchanges In Wide-Area Networks (AREA)

Abstract

La présente invention concerne un procédé et un système pour appliquer des adresses de réseau virtuel dans une liaison de réseau. Le procédé comprend les étapes suivantes : acquérir le nombre de terminaux auxquels il a été accédé dans un réseau local, et si le nombre dépasse une valeur seuil définie, attribuer des adresses de réseau virtuel aux terminaux ; ajouter le nombre de paquets de données à des champs d'en-tête de paquet des paquets de données ; et si des paquets de données envoyés par les terminaux avec les adresses de réseau virtuel sont reçus, remplacer des adresses de réseau virtuel dans les paquets de données par des adresses IP locales. La solution technique de la présente invention présente l'avantage d'offrir une bonne expérience utilisateur.
PCT/CN2017/085971 2017-05-25 2017-05-25 Procédé et système d'application d'adresses de réseau virtuel dans une liaison de réseau Ceased WO2018214113A1 (fr)

Priority Applications (1)

Application Number Priority Date Filing Date Title
PCT/CN2017/085971 WO2018214113A1 (fr) 2017-05-25 2017-05-25 Procédé et système d'application d'adresses de réseau virtuel dans une liaison de réseau

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
PCT/CN2017/085971 WO2018214113A1 (fr) 2017-05-25 2017-05-25 Procédé et système d'application d'adresses de réseau virtuel dans une liaison de réseau

Publications (1)

Publication Number Publication Date
WO2018214113A1 true WO2018214113A1 (fr) 2018-11-29

Family

ID=64395143

Family Applications (1)

Application Number Title Priority Date Filing Date
PCT/CN2017/085971 Ceased WO2018214113A1 (fr) 2017-05-25 2017-05-25 Procédé et système d'application d'adresses de réseau virtuel dans une liaison de réseau

Country Status (1)

Country Link
WO (1) WO2018214113A1 (fr)

Citations (5)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N1770779A (zh) * 2004-11-05 2006-05-10 泛泰·科力特株式会社 对分配给移动站的ip地址进行管理的方法和系统
US20080040573A1 (en) * 2006-08-08 2008-02-14 Malloy Patrick J Mapping virtual internet protocol addresses
CN101355469A (zh) * 2007-07-26 2009-01-28 华为技术有限公司 网络地址的处理方法与路由节点
CN105871631A (zh) * 2016-05-31 2016-08-17 武汉光迅科技股份有限公司 一种基于snmp协议找回丢失ip的方法
CN107071090A (zh) * 2017-05-25 2017-08-18 深圳市伊特利网络科技有限公司 虚拟网络地址在网路链接中的应用方法及系统

Patent Citations (5)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N1770779A (zh) * 2004-11-05 2006-05-10 泛泰·科力特株式会社 对分配给移动站的ip地址进行管理的方法和系统
US20080040573A1 (en) * 2006-08-08 2008-02-14 Malloy Patrick J Mapping virtual internet protocol addresses
CN101355469A (zh) * 2007-07-26 2009-01-28 华为技术有限公司 网络地址的处理方法与路由节点
CN105871631A (zh) * 2016-05-31 2016-08-17 武汉光迅科技股份有限公司 一种基于snmp协议找回丢失ip的方法
CN107071090A (zh) * 2017-05-25 2017-08-18 深圳市伊特利网络科技有限公司 虚拟网络地址在网路链接中的应用方法及系统

Similar Documents

Publication Publication Date Title
WO2018214059A1 (fr) Procédé et système de sélection de liaison de données dans un réseau
WO2018209644A1 (fr) Procédé et système de chiffrement de données pour logement domotique
WO2018214113A1 (fr) Procédé et système d'application d'adresses de réseau virtuel dans une liaison de réseau
WO2018227334A1 (fr) Procédé et système de recommandation de sources de logement pour application de maisons d'occasion
WO2018018424A1 (fr) Procédé de régulation de température et système sur puce associé
WO2018214108A1 (fr) Système et procédé de mise en œuvre sécurisée destinés à une liaison de réseau
WO2018214112A1 (fr) Procédé et système permettant de maintenir une adresse ip dans une liaison de réseau
WO2018223552A1 (fr) Procédé et système de sortie rapide d'application de terminal
WO2018214057A1 (fr) Procédé et système de calcul concernant la perte de paquets dans une liaison de réseau
WO2018214058A1 (fr) Procédé et système d'établissement d'une liaison de réseau pour des terminaux face à face
WO2018209511A1 (fr) Procédé et système de mise à jour d'une application dans un terminal
WO2018218616A1 (fr) Procédé et système de définition d'invite de contact spécifique
WO2018227364A1 (fr) Procédé et système d'établissement de groupe de multidiffusion de terminal
WO2018214106A1 (fr) Procédé et système de mise à jour pour liste de connexions réseau
WO2018214110A1 (fr) Procédé et système de sélection de liaison sur la base d'un point d'accès
WO2018027576A1 (fr) Procédé et système de collecte de durée de fonctionnement dans des statistiques dans l'internet des objets
WO2018227370A1 (fr) Procédé et système de sélection de connexion de réseau de terminaux
WO2018214056A1 (fr) Procédé et système de vérification de retard dans une liaison de réseau
WO2018205129A1 (fr) Procédé et système de planification de nombre de camions d'incendie intervenant dans la lutte contre un incendie
WO2018214021A1 (fr) Procédé et système de partage de destination entre plateformes
WO2018214061A1 (fr) Procédé et système de chiffrement de liaison de réseau basé sur un terminal
WO2018027577A1 (fr) Procédé et système d'application pour une application de télévision dans l'internet des objets
WO2018227333A1 (fr) Procédé et un système de recommandation d'application de terminal basé sur le positionnement
WO2018218412A1 (fr) Procédé et système d'attribution d'espace de stationnement à un bus standard dans une circulation routière intelligente
WO2018214016A1 (fr) Procédé et système basés sur le positionnement pour rassembler des joueurs dans le jeu fight the landlord

Legal Events

Date Code Title Description
121 Ep: the epo has been informed by wipo that ep was designated in this application

Ref document number: 17910889

Country of ref document: EP

Kind code of ref document: A1

NENP Non-entry into the national phase

Ref country code: DE

122 Ep: pct application non-entry in european phase

Ref document number: 17910889

Country of ref document: EP

Kind code of ref document: A1